WebI.M. Pei’s Dallas City Hall, completed in 1977, is an imposing Modernist monument of cantilevered buff concrete, a color chosen to resemble Texas’ earth tones. L3 is supposedly filled with water … fisher\u0027s nuts recipesWebThe idea of a new city hall for Dallas emerged in the mid-1960s, as part of a program of "Goals for Dallas" designed to restore the city's reputation after the assassination of President Kennedy. As Pei recalls, I felt that Dallas was the greatest city there was, and I could not disappoint them." can antibiotics make you nauseous
